Mazda 3: Why it should be on your shortlist

Mazda 3

One of the new Mazda’s to have hit our shores is the 3. It comes in fastback form, essentially as a Mazda3 saloon – think four-door Audi A3 or Merc CLA – but one that blends hatch and saloon genres into one svelte, clean shape. For that we thank KODO, Mazda’s design language.

Providing the go is a trend-bucking 2.0 litre naturally aspirated petrol motor, linked to a six speed automatic ‘box. No turbo power here. They’ve still squeezed 121kW and 210 torques from the motor which is plenty for the average customer. More importantly they’ve kept fuel consumption to a minimum at 5.9 l/100km.

Mazda 3The chassis is very capable, up there with the class best for control and enjoyment. The wide track means the 3 feels stable while it’s steering is well-weighted, quick and accurate. The engineers have done their utmost to keep that oh-so-tricky balance between comfort and fun. They’ve definitely leaned toward the fun side, so the ride can be rough at times, but the 3 makes up for it on twisty back roads.

Mazda 3Inside you’re met with Mazda’s usual generous helping of bang for your buck. This top-of-the-range Astina comes with everything that opens and shuts; like a heads up display, cruise control, keyless go and a 7 inch multimedia screen with sat-nav and all kinds of connectivity including internet radio, Facebook and Twitter. And while we’re talking value for money, there’s a 3 year unlimited km service plan (take note fleet managers).

The interior is comparatively bland against the striking outward appearance. It’s functional though, doesn’t feel overly cheap and is well configured. The rear section might not be as big as you’d like, but the boot is cavernous; its 55 litres bigger than the hatch and therefore much more practical.

Good economy, sporty feel and nice interior round off the 3 as a great alternative to the Ford Focus, VW Golf and the rest of the non-premium gang. Make sure it’s on your shortlist.

Price: R326,300
Engine: 2.0 litre four cylinder petrol
Power (kW): 121
Torque (Nm): 210
Consumption (l/100km): 5.9 (claimed)
Service: 3 year unlimited km
